v2ray简介
v2ray 是一款广泛使用的网络代理软件,它能在不同网络环境中提供安全、灵活的网络访问方案。然而,在安装过程中,用户可能会遇到 v2ray不能安装 的问题。本文将深入探讨这一问题的常见原因、防范措施以及解决方案,帮助用户顺利完成安装。
v2ray无法安装的常见原因
1. 系统兼容性问题
- 系统版本不符合要求:v2ray存在不同版本,只适用于特定的操作系统。例如,Windows、Debian、Ubuntu等。
- 操作系统缺乏最新的补丁或更新:确保系统更新到最新状态,提高安装成功率。
2. 安装程序错误
- 下载文件损坏:如果在下载过程中的网络不稳定,导致安装包文件不完整。
- 鉴权问题:部分版本需下载密钥或许可证。
3. 依赖包缺失
- v2ray需要其他软件包的支持,如果这些软件包没有预先安装,则可能导致安装失败。例如:Docker、Git等。
- 熟悉v2ray的依赖关系,可以提前进行环境配置。
4. 网络环境不适应
- 防火墙阻挡:在国内,很多网络服务可能会被防火墙拦截,导致安装过程中无法正常通信。
- DNS设置不当:部分DNS服务在访问特定网站时可能存在 ограничение,导致安装失败。
v2ray安装检查清单
在开始安装之前,请确保已完成以下检查:
- 确保使用支持的操作系统版本。
- 下载最新的v2ray安装程序。
- 检查系统依赖包是否完整。
- 确认网络防火墙和代理设置正常。
如何解决v2ray无法安装的问题
步骤1:检查操作系统
请在官方网站查看v2ray的系统要求,确认操作系统与所需的v2ray版本兼容。向下兼容通常存在,但最好使用最新版本。
步骤2:下载正确的安装包
建议从官方下载链接下载v2ray的最新版本。下载时,避免在使用不稳定的网络环境,如公共WiFi,以免文件损坏。
步骤3:配置依赖项
若依赖包尚未安装,可通过以下步骤进行配置:
-
在Linux系统中使用如下命令安装必要依赖:
sh
sudo apt-get update sudo apt-get install git curl -
在Windows系统则确保.NET Framework 等必备组件已安装。
步骤4:调整网络设置
尝试通过修改网络设置来解决相关问题:
- 进入Windows防火墙设置,确认v2ray应用被允许通过。
- 确保系统DNS设置一般可用,如设置为8.8.8.8和不确定的可用。
常见问题解答(FAQ)
Q1: v2ray的安装失败有什么提示吗?
一般情况下,错误提示会告知用户具体问题所在。例如:文件未找到、权限不足、网络连接失败等。
Q2: 我能在移动设备上安装v2ray吗?
是的!移动设备如Android和iOS上也支持v2ray,但请确保下载适合该平台的版本,并根据移动端的特点进行必要配置。
Q3: 如何确认v2ray是否已成功安装?
可以通过运行命令行查看v2ray的版本消息,通常显示v2ray与更新日志信息,确认其已安装成功。
Q4: v2ray安装后如何设置配置文件?
安装完成后,你会在 v2ray 的安装目录下找到 config.json 文件,按照官方文档的说明进行相应修改与配置。
Q5: 如果修改配置后不能连接,如何排查问题?
可以先检查是否配置正确且符合网络特性,再根据 v2ray 的日志进行排查,特别查看哪些请求被拒绝。
小结
通过上述分析和解决方案,希望解决 v2ray不能安装 的问题能为用户提供帮助。在进行安装时,请始终确保遵循步骤,以最大化安装成功的机会。如果仍有疑问,欢迎咨询社区或寻求专业支持。